Sika Antisol® A (20L & 200L)

Brand : Sika

Product Type : Water-dispersed, acrylic copolymer based concrete curing compound

Size : 20 Litres, 200 Litres

Colour : Milky White Liquid

Consumption : 5–6.5 m² per litre depending on wind, humidity and temperature conditions

 

Product Description:

Sika® Antisol® A is a water-dispersed acrylic copolymer based curing compound. It is ready for use and simple to apply. Sika® Antisol® A will form a thin film, covering the surface of the concrete to prevent premature water loss due to evaporation.

 

Usage:

Sika® Antisol® A is sprayed onto newly placed concrete surfaces to form a thin film barrier against premature water loss, without disturbing the normal setting action. Sika® Antisol® A is suitable where subsequent surface treatments such as screed, protective coating, decorative paint, etc. are required.

 

Features / Advantages:

Sika® Antisol® A provides the following beneficial properties to concrete surfaces:

  • Reduces incidence of plastic cracking
  • Reduces shrinkage
  • Reduces dusting
  • Increases frost resistance
  • Replaces labour intensive curing methods such as wet-Hessian, watering, etc.
  • Can be overcoated without affecting the bonding of the subsequent application (concrete surfaces to be washed prior to overcoating in accordance with normal practice)
  • Will not re-emulsify in contact with water therefore allows overcoating even where back pressure of water is expected

 

Shelf Life:

  • 6 months from the date of production

 

Storage:

  • Stored properly in original, unopened and undamaged sealed packaging in dry conditions. Keep away from direct sunlight.

 

Application Steps:

Step 1 : Pre-Application

Sika® Antisol® A is ready to use. Do not dilute. Stir well before use.

 

Step 2 : 

Sika® Antisol® A curing compound can be sprayed, brushed or rolled onto newly placed concrete. Apply as soon as possible after final trowelling when surface water has disappeared (approximately ½–2 hours depending on ambient conditions).

 

For vertical surfaces, apply immediately after removal of formwork.

 

Step 3 : 

After application, the area must be protected from rain for at least 2–3 hours.

 

Sika® Antisol® A is transparent after curing.

 

Step 3 : 

Clean all tools and application equipment with water immediately after use. Hardened and/or cured material can only be removed mechanically.
